Customer Service Representative - Sauget, IL
Watco is seeking a detail-oriented Customer Service Representative to support daily operations at our Sauget terminal. This office-based role is highly computer and Excel focused, requiring precise data entry, dual verification of critical information, and regular coordination with drivers, customers, and operations teams. The position plays a key role in maintaining accurate documentation, clear communication, and efficient terminal operations within a multi-service marine and rail facility.
